I think the ENB'ishness comes from the games consoles, it was done for one of the GTA games. So lots of bloom effects and lens flare kinds of effects, which the human eye never sees.

I suppose in certain atmospheric conditions it might work, but not at low level, when you can see the ground, when you can see clouds or when you are looking at an aircraft........which doesn't leave much :lol:
